Image use & copyright

Disclaimer

These photographs were purchased at auction, most likely as part of a house clearance. Based on that, I assume in good faith that I now hold both physical and copyright ownership. Technically, copyright remains with the original photographer unless formally transferred—but in cases like this, where the originator is unknown and likely deceased, I believe the risk of infringement is minimal. If you are the copyright holder or a family member and would prefer an image to be removed from public view, please contact me and I will take it down promptly.

Privacy

I only share images that have historical interest—this might include backgrounds, fashion, or everyday activities. I take great care when deciding what to publish. If a person appears likely to still be alive, or if the photo depicts a private setting (like someone standing outside their own front door), I may choose to blur the face or exclude the image entirely. On the other hand, posed public images—like a shopkeeper standing proudly in their store—are more likely to be included. Context and respect are the guiding principles.

Helping Lost Photos Find Home

In some cases, I publish photographs with the hope—however small—that a relative or descendant might recognise someone and wish to reclaim a piece of their family's history. These images may be of personal events or group gatherings that appear to have sentimental or community value. If that ever happens, I’d be happy to hear from you.
